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79642 79804 7860365 770
439 885 95316530977
439 885 95316530977
7953077 99863 8754
All about undefined
Interested in learning more?
439 885 95316530977
7953077 99863 8754
See more
6110119754 02 62218
02106698440 852634921 807 1963568
See more
500935 32
38539 6350606191 748
See more